I must say Andrew Lloyd Webber sure got some balls to do a musical about Jesus. I checked the extra materials on the Jesus Christ Superstar DVD when i watched it the other day. Apparently it was quite a riot about it during the 70's when it first started to play... Was interesting to see. Even more interesting is that said musical was running that long! They showed pictures from the 25th anniversary! I think it was running a few more years then that. Quite amazing.

I just happened to be in a Catholic grammar school when J.C. Superstar (as it was known) premiered. It was an interesting place to be. The old nuns were horrified, the young priests were all for it.

Personally, I thought it was a bit overblown as is all of Webber's stuff but, I did love the way they portrayed King Herod as a funny comedic type. There was one great line I'll never forget. Herod's interrogating Jesus and sings,

"Prove to me that you're no fool.
Walk across my swimming pool."

The teachers were all for it in my Catholic school but there was a boatload of hippie teachers. My cousin fangirled Tim Neeley like whoa.

Now when Godspell happened, there seemed to be more rumblings (though my school used the album as part of both the music and religion classes at the time). People were more up in arms about a Jewfro-wearing guy in a Superman t-shirt. plaid pants and Keds with pompoms on them playing a Christ figure than they were about a long-haired guy in a robe playing teh Christ.
